Arctic primrose (Primula pumila) blooming on the aptly named Primrose Ridge near Mt. Margaret in Denali National Park. One of the earliest alpine tundra flowers, it often blooms before the grasses green up. It’s also one of my favorites!

We call this white brush, but some of the old-timers called it bee brush because pollinators love it. Thickets of it bloom en masse about a week after a good rain, and if the rains keep coming, it just keeps blooming over and over all summer long. Its blossoms smell incredible.
